Bucks usually don't evaluate your wheeze or grunt. It's just to get their attention.....then you need a mix of buck urine and doe estrus pee......that gets them walking to you....then they make the mistake. I've found the grunt is the best....forget the rest of the calls....must have pee during rut unless you are just plain lucky that day.....The big pressured bucks don't like moving in the day unless they are with an estrus doe. Estrus and buck urine will pull them out of their hidden spot.
